## Deployment

The Quellhorn autoscaler polls queue depth every ten seconds and scales worker pods between fixed bounds. Scaling decisions are logged with the actor identity so reviewers can audit every change. No credentials are embedded in the manifest; secrets mount at runtime. The current production configuration values are listed below.

settings of tagef-bawif:
DRUIX_HOST=druix.zemvarlabs.internal
DRUIX_PORT=8000

## Approvals: Leaked FD Hunt (Brambleworks Gateway)

The descriptor leak in the Brambleworks ingest gateway has been traced to the socket pool under burst reconnects. The mitigation patch caps pool growth and adds an fd-count alarm at 80% of the ulimit. On-call should restart only the affected pods, not the full fleet. Rollout to production requires one approval before Thursday's freeze. Sign-off authority for this change rests with the engineer named below.

named custodian: Brivan Eliath Quenox Frador

Loyalty overhaul status: old Meridane points scheme sunsets end of quarter. New tiers (Bronze/Silver/Crest) launch with double-accrual promo, four weeks only. Migration of existing balances handled by the Penfold team; expect customer noise in week one. Sales leads: pitch Crest tier to top-200 accounts first. Redemption catalogue is trimmed — check before promising anything. Budget is locked; no discretionary bonus points without my sign-off, now Sella's. Rationale for the timing sits in the confidential note below.

board note of kageg-bahof: The renewal with Holwynax Holdings closes at $2 million a year, 5 percent below the last contract. Project Ulaath slips by two quarters because of the supplier delay.

Welcome to the Striderline crew. Your first task involves the ChipGate Mk4 reader, which sits at each timing mat and decodes passive tags as runners cross. Always power the reader through the filtered supply, never raw generator output, because voltage spikes corrupt the read buffer silently. After setup, run the self-test loop twice and confirm the antenna tune value sits between 4.2 and 4.6. Calibration tolerances, wiring diagrams, and the pre-race checklist are all maintained on the internal page linked below.

operations page: https://jenkins.zemvarcloud.local/job/merge_requests/repo/build/73930b4b30f0a8ed